数字货币硬件钱包的实现原理揭秘
引言
随着金融科技的飞速发展,数字货币迅速崛起,成为全球投资者关注的热点。然而,数字货币的安全性问题依然是用户最大的担忧之一。数字货币硬件钱包作为一种有力的安全工具,以其独特的实现原理和强大的安全防护措施,受到越来越多用户的青睐。本文将深入探讨数字货币硬件钱包的实现原理及其如何确保资产安全,并解答相关常见问题。
一、数字货币硬件钱包概述
数字货币硬件钱包是一种专门用于存储和管理数字资产(如比特币、以太坊等)私钥的物理设备。与软件钱包相比,硬件钱包具备更高的安全性,能够有效地防止黑客攻击和恶意软件的侵害。这种钱包通常以USB、Bluetooth等方式与计算机或移动设备连接,用户可以通过硬件钱包进行数字货币的发送、接收和管理。
二、硬件钱包的基本构造与功能
硬件钱包通常由如下几个主要部分构成:
- 处理器:负责处理所有的钱包逻辑和加密算法,确保私钥的安全存储和使用。
- 存储器:存储私钥、助记词和各种交易记录,确保信息不被篡改。
- 安全模块:防止物理攻击,如侧信道攻击(side-channel attack)和解密攻击。
- 用户接口:通常包括屏幕、按键或触摸屏,帮助用户进行操作。
三、数字货币硬件钱包的实现原理
数字货币硬件钱包的安全性主要依赖以下几个核心原理:
1. 私钥管理
硬件钱包的私钥绝对不离开设备,它会在设备内部进行生成与存储。即使连接到不安全的计算机上,私钥也不会被泄露。硬件钱包在每次交易时,会利用私钥进行签名,这个过程在设备内部完成,确保私钥的安全。
2. 加密算法
硬件钱包通常采用业界标准的加密算法(如AES、RSA等)来加密其内部数据,保护数据储存的安全性。通过强大的加密技术,即使设备被盗,黑客也很难在没有密码的情况下获取用户的资产信息。
3. 安全认证
许多硬件钱包采用多重安全认证机制,例如密码、PIN码和生物识别(如指纹识别或面部识别)。这些认证手段确保只有授权用户才能访问和使用钱包。
4. 物理安全性
为防止物理攻击,硬件钱包通常内置特殊的安全措施,如防篡改封闭外壳和自毁机制。若检测到物理攻击,设备会自动将私钥清除,避免信息被盗取。
5. 事务签名
在进行交易时,硬件钱包不会直接将私钥暴露给外部设备,而是通过生成交易的唯一签名来确认交易的合法性。这样,私钥可以在保证安全的情况下,完成所有必要的操作。
四、数字货币硬件钱包的优势
数字货币硬件钱包相较于软件钱包的优势显而易见。
- 安全性高:硬件钱包将私钥离线存储,极大降低了黑客攻击的风险。
- 便捷性强:用户可以轻松进行交易,同时拥有较高的安全保障。
- 多币种支持:许多硬件钱包支持多种数字货币,方便用户管理不同类型的资产。
五、可能相关的问题
如何选择合适的硬件钱包?
选择硬件钱包时,用户应考虑以下几个因素:
- 安全性:优先查看硬件钱包的安全认证和用户口碑,确保其具有良好的安全记录。
- 兼容性:确保设备支持所需的数字货币和操作系统。
- 易用性:使用界面是否友好,设置过程是否简便。
- 价格:根据预算来选择满足需求的硬件钱包品牌。
通过综合考虑以上因素,用户可以选择出适合自己的硬件钱包。
硬件钱包安全吗?和软件钱包相比有哪些优势?
硬件钱包因其固有的设计和实现原理,具备更高的安全性。与软件钱包相比,硬件钱包的优势主要体现在以下几点:
- 私钥离线存储:硬件钱包将私钥保存在物理设备中,而软件钱包的私钥可能存储在在线系统中,这使得硬件钱包更不易被攻击。
- 物理防护:许多硬件钱包具备防篡改和自毁机制,若遭遇攻击则会迅速清除私钥。
这样设计的硬件钱包在安全性上有着显著优势,因此更适合存储大额资金。
如何备份和恢复硬件钱包的数据?
备份和恢复数据的流程通常包括以下几个步骤:
- 助记词备份:在首次设置硬件钱包时,系统会生成一组助记词。在存储私钥之前,请务必将其妥善记录并保存在安全的地点。
- 安全存储:在备份时,可以将助记词复制到纸质文档,并存放在安全的地方,如保险柜。
- 恢复流程:在需要恢复钱包时,通过助记词重新生成私钥即可恢复钱包的状态。
通过妥善备份和恢复,用户可以有效防止失去对钱包的访问。
如何进行硬件钱包的日常使用?
日常使用硬件钱包以管理数字货币相对简单:
- 连接设备:将硬件钱包与计算机或移动设备连接。
- 输入PIN码:在设备上输入PIN码进行身份验证。
- 进行交易:用户可以选择转账或收款,设备会生成相应的签名,确保交易安全。
用户每次交易时,请务必检查交易详情以确保信息的准确性。
硬件钱包在哪些情况下可能会失去安全性?
尽管硬件钱包提供了较高的安全性,但以下情况可能导致安全性降低:
- 设备损坏或丢失:若硬件钱包丢失或遭受严重损坏,可能会导致用户无法访问资金。
- 助记词泄露:如果助记词被他人获取,用户的资金会因此面临风险。
- 恶意软件干扰:尽管硬件钱包本身安全,但如果连接设备受到恶意软件的影响,仍可能产生安全隐患。
因此,用户应定期检查设备的状态,并确保使用安全的计算环境。
总结
数字货币硬件钱包通过独特的实现原理和严密的安全设计,为用户提供了一个安全且便捷的资产管理工具。了解这些原理不仅有助于用户更好地使用硬件钱包,还能够在数字货币投资的过程中大大降低风险。在进行数字资产管理时,务必注重安全性,选择合适的硬件钱包、妥善备份数据和定期检查设备状态,确保资产安全。希望本文对您深入了解数字货币硬件钱包的实现原理提供了很好的帮助。